廣東 炖汤•蒸鱼 Canton Delicacies, which is started by Chef Ericson Ng, a former chef at Singapore Marriott Tang Plaza Hotel, serves Cantonese-style steamed dishes, soups and curry fish head.

Hailing from Malaysia, Chef Ericson started working in restaurants in Ipoh when he was just 13. He relocated to Singapore after securing a job at Wan Hao Chinese Restaurant. There, he gained 11 years of experience and climbed the ranks to become a junior sous chef. After a meeting with a Hong Kong-born hawker, whom Chef Ericson dubs as his ‘shifu’, Chef Ericson decided to learn under him for three years and eventually set out to run his own hawker stall in 2020.

If you’re a first time customer like me, the vast menu options might be a little daunting, but it can be simply split into several categories of items – steamed dishes, double-boiled soups, and fish head dishes.

I tried one of the stall’s cheapest and most popular dishes: Salted Egg Pork Patties Steamed Rice ($3.30), which comes with a thick minced pork patty comprising an 80 to 20 meat-to-fat ratio, salted egg, and a bed of fluffy rice. The patty was then drizzled with dark soya sauce. The patty was juicy and tender, and the sauce delivered sweetness and savouriness.

Next, I had the Steamed Garlic Prawn with Vermicelli ($8). As I bit into the prawn, the freshness and slight sweetness of the meat was evident. I only wished that the garlic sauce that was heavily drizzled over the prawns was less salty.

Chef Ericson recommended that I try his latest creation, the Steamed Garlic Lala ($8). Each lala was plump, well-seasoned with chilli and garlic, and carried the perfect amount of umami.
